The 10 Pillars for Communicating the Price Increase Message

A price increase can be a delicate topic. Communicating it properly is essential to maintain trust and loyalty among customers. Here are ten essential pillars to ensure your price increase notice is effective and well received.

1. Transparency in Communication

You must be clear and honest about the reasons for the increase. Inform your customers about the circumstances that led to this decision, such as rising supply costs or investments in improvements.

2. Anticipation

Avoid unpleasant surprises by notifying your customers well in advance about the price increase. An early notice gives them the opportunity to adjust their budgets accordingly.

3. Empathy in the Message

Acknowledging how the price increase may affect your customers shows empathy. Let them know that you understand their concerns and that you are committed to providing them with the best value.

4. Offer Alternatives

Offering options, such as maintaining current prices for contracts renewed before a specific date, can help soften the impact of the increase.

5. Added Value

Reinforce the value of your products or services during the communication of the increase. Highlight how the improvements justify the new price and benefit the customer.

6. Communication Channels

Use multiple channels to communicate the notice, such as emails, social media, and your website. Consistency in messaging across different platforms is key.

7. Maintain the Relationship

Use this opportunity to strengthen the relationship with your customers. Utilize the notice as a chance to facilitate any inquiries they may have.

8. Train Your Team

Ensure that your team is well-informed about the price increase and prepared to respond to questions. This contributes to consistent and professional communication.

9. Encourage Feedback

Invite your customers to share their thoughts about the change. This feedback not only shows that you value their perspective but also provides valuable insights.

10. Follow Up After the Notice

After communicating the price increase, follow up. Ask if they have any questions or need more information, which can help ensure their satisfaction.

Avoiding Common Mistakes When Communicating Price Increases

When communicating a price increase, avoid common mistakes to ensure effective communication. A lack of sufficient context can make acceptance difficult. Detailing how production costs justify the increase helps customers see value beyond the cost.

A message with a cold tone can lead to negative reactions. Your notice should be perceived as a conversation that shows you value the customer. A general notice may not resonate with all segments of your clientele. Personalizing the message is essential.

Ideally, announce the increase with sufficient advance notice, allowing customers time to adjust. Failing to communicate in advance can lead to distrust and discomfort. Also, ensure you have follow-up after the notice to clarify doubts and show that you value their feedback.
